West Indies tour game reduced to two-day affair
West Indies’ three-day warm-up match, prior to the Test series, has been reduced to a two-day affair because of the condition of the ground in Savar. The BKSP ground, which was slated to host the match between the West Indians and a BCB XI from November 8, has not dried sufficiently to be fit for play following a week of wet weather, and will now start on Friday.
